The Middleware Infrastructure Team is hosting the first official IAMUCLA Mini-Conference on April 15, 2008. IAMUCLA(Identity & Access Management @ UCLA) is the new program name for what some of you may know as EDIMI. Basically, that's ISIS, Shibboleth, UCLA Logon, Enterprise Directory, and a few other things we will be announcing.

We will cover the following at this 2 hour event:
- IAMUCLAOverview
- What is it, what services are available?
- IAMUCLARoadmap
- IAMUCLA Wiki Launch (preview at: https://spaces.ais.ucla.edu/iamucla)
- ISIS to Shibboleth Migration
- Migration Roadmap
- Shibboleth Architecture
- Shibboleth Service Provider Set Up
- Q & A
This is a technical session, and we hope to keep this event demo-heavy. Specifically, we will devote a significant portion of the event to a live demonstration of how to set up an Apache/Tomcat web application to integrate with UCLA's Shibboleth single sign-on environment.
